(330ml bottle) Bieropholie Order. The labels on these bottles crack me up... its like Jones Soda. Pours a medium, hazy golden body with a sediment filled, white frothy head. Nose of lemon and pepper. Flavour is far more spiced than expected: citrus, cardamom, lemon zest, and very yeasty. Good.

Hazy yellow gold hue, with a frothy white head, leaving some laces, subtle floral hops nose with a spicy peppery ginseng accent, sweet pale malt aroma follows through on a medium-bodied palate with a crisp sweet pale malt, with a yeasty dough note, spicy ginseng, hint of citrus fruits, leading towards a smooth mild spicy hops bitterness finish.
